Website Developers in Kenya: Types of Web Hosting and How to Choose the Best

Website Developers in Kenya

A functional, fast, and reliable website is crucial for any business. But behind every great website lies a solid web hosting solution. Choosing the right hosting can make or break your website’s performance, affecting user experience, search engine rankings, and even your business’s bottom line.

Whether you’re a business owner in Kenya or working with website developers in Kenya, understanding the various hosting options is key to success. This guide explains web hosting in detail, why it’s essential, the different types of hosting available, and how to select the right one for your business.

What is Web Hosting and Why Do You Need It?

Web hosting is essentially the service that stores your website’s files on a server, allowing users to access it on the internet. Without hosting, your website is invisible and inaccessible. Every time someone types your website’s URL, a server hosts your files and delivers the content to the user’s browser.

Why Do You Need Web Hosting?

  • Accessibility: A reliable hosting provider ensures your website is live 24/7, so customers can visit your site anytime.
  • Storage and Security: Hosting providers keep your website files secure and backed up in case of any issues.
  • Website Performance: The type of hosting impacts your site’s speed, which is a critical factor in user satisfaction and search engine optimization.
  • Technical Support: Professional hosting services provide customer support to resolve technical challenges, allowing you to focus on running your business.

Different Types of Web Hosting

Choosing the right type of hosting depends on your website’s needs, budget, and technical expertise. Here are the main types of web hosting available in the market today:

 1. Shared Hosting

Shared hosting is the most affordable and beginner-friendly hosting option. It means your website shares resources with other websites on the same server.


  • Cost-Effective: Ideal for small businesses or personal websites on a tight budget.
  • User-Friendly: Comes with easy-to-use control panels like cPanel or Plesk.
  • Maintenance-Free: The hosting provider takes care of server management.


  • Limited Resources: Sharing with other websites can slow down your website if one site experiences high traffic.
  • Security Concerns: Vulnerabilities in other websites on the server could affect yours.
  • Restricted Customization: You have less control over server settings.

2. Virtual Private Server (VPS) Hosting

VPS hosting is a middle ground between shared and dedicated hosting. You share the server, but your website gets a dedicated portion of resources in a virtualized environment.


  • Better Performance: Dedicated resources ensure more consistent performance compared to shared hosting.
  • Scalable: You can easily add resources as your website grows.
  • More Control: You have more control over settings and configurations.


  • Higher Cost: More expensive than shared hosting.
  • Technical Management: Requires some technical knowledge to manage.

3. Dedicated Server Hosting

Dedicated server hosting means you have an entire server dedicated to your website, offering full control and maximum performance.


  • Full Control: Customize the server to meet your specific needs.
  • High Security: No other websites share your server, reducing security risks.
  • Maximum Performance: Ideal for high-traffic websites that need fast load times.


  • Costly: It is typically one of the most expensive hosting options.
  • Requires Expertise: You’ll need technical knowledge or hire professionals to manage it.

4. Managed Hosting

Managed hosting takes care of all server management tasks, such as updates, security, and backups, allowing you to focus on your website.


  • Hassle-Free: The hosting provider handles maintenance, security, and performance optimization.
  • Regular Updates: Your server is kept secure and up to date with the latest technology.
  • Premium Support: Managed hosting often comes with priority customer support.


  • Higher Costs: Managed hosting is more expensive than unmanaged options.
  • Limited Control: You might not have full access to server settings.

5. Colocation Hosting

With colocation hosting, you rent space in a data center but own the server yourself. The hosting provider supplies the infrastructure, such as power, cooling, and network access.


  • Full Hardware Control: You have complete control over the physical server.
  • High Performance: You get access to advanced data center infrastructure, improving reliability and speed.


  • High Initial Investment: You need to purchase and manage your own hardware.
  • Technical Complexity: Requires in-depth knowledge to manage and troubleshoot your server.

6. Cloud Hosting

Cloud hosting distributes your website across multiple servers, allowing for dynamic scalability. Resources can be increased or decreased as needed, making it ideal for growing websites.


  • Scalability: Easily adjust resources based on demand.
  • High Uptime: If one server goes down, another takes over, ensuring your website stays online.
  • Cost-Effective: You pay for the resources you use, making it a flexible option.


  • Complex Billing: Costs can vary based on usage, making it harder to predict expenses.
  • Technical Management: Requires some technical know-how to manage.

7. WordPress Hosting

WordPress hosting is specifically designed for WordPress websites, offering optimized performance, security, and features tailored to the platform.


  • Optimized Performance: Servers are configured to ensure fast load times for WordPress sites.
  • Pre-installed Plugins and Themes: The hosting package often comes with pre-installed features to simplify setup.
  • Enhanced Security: Designed to protect against common WordPress vulnerabilities.


  • Limited to WordPress: Not suitable for websites built on other platforms.
  • Costlier Than Shared Hosting: While it offers benefits, it can be more expensive than general hosting.

8. Reseller Hosting

Reseller hosting allows you to purchase hosting services in bulk and then resell them to clients. It’s a popular option for web development agencies that want to offer hosting services.


  • Additional Revenue Stream: Great for website designers in Kenya looking to expand their services.
  • Custom Packages: You can create customized hosting plans for your clients.
  • No Server Management: The hosting provider handles server maintenance.


  • Upfront Costs: You need to purchase hosting in bulk.
  • Management Responsibility: You will be responsible for managing your clients’ hosting accounts and support.

Also Read: Web App Development: How to Choose the Right Company

How to Choose the Best Type of Hosting for Your Website

Choosing the right hosting depends on several factors. Here’s a breakdown of what to consider when making your decision:

1. Website Traffic: If you expect high traffic, VPS, cloud, or dedicated hosting is your best option. Shared hosting may not handle large traffic spikes well.

2. Budget: If you’re on a limited budget, shared hosting or WordPress hosting might be the best options to start with. As your business grows, you can scale up to VPS or cloud hosting.

3. Technical Expertise: If you lack technical skills, managed hosting is ideal as the provider handles server management. On the other hand, if you are tech-savvy, VPS or dedicated hosting gives you more control over configurations.

4. Scalability: If you expect your website to grow rapidly, opt for cloud hosting or VPS hosting, both of which offer easy scalability.

5. Specific Needs: If your website is built on WordPress, using WordPress hosting ensures optimized performance for the platform.

By working with professional Kenya web developers, you can get expert advice on the best hosting solution for your specific website. Keep in mind that choosing the right hosting service is critical to your website’s performance, security, and user experience.


Your website’s success relies heavily on choosing the right web hosting service. Whether you’re a business owner or collaborating with website developers in Kenya, understanding your hosting options can help you make an informed decision. From cost-effective shared hosting to powerful cloud solutions, there is an option to suit every website’s needs.

If you’re unsure which hosting is right for your business, consult experienced website designers in Kenya. They can guide you through the process and recommend the best hosting solution based on your budget, traffic, and technical requirements. Ready to take your website to the next level? Contact us today for expert advice!

About the Author

Leave a Reply

Your email address will not be published. Required fields are marked *

You may also like these